What are the 4 types of DBMS?
What are the 4 types of DBMS? A Database Management System (DBMS) is a software application that allows users to manage and organize data efficiently. The four types of DBMS are Relational DBMS (RDBMS), Hierarchical DBMS, Network DBMS, and Object-Oriented DBMS (OODBMS).

What is the language used by most of the DBMS for helping their uses to access data?
The correct answer SQL. SQL stands for Structured Query Language. It is a standardized programming language that's used to manage relational databases and perform various operations on the data in them.

What is meant by DBMS?
A Database Management System (DBMS) is a software system that allows users to create, define, manipulate and manage databases. It provides a way for organizations to store, organize and retrieve large amounts of data quickly and efficiently in an organized manner.
